About Ascoli Piceno
Ascoli Piceno's history stretches back to the Piceni people and flourished under Roman rule, evident in landmarks like the Roman Bridge (Ponte di Cecco) and the ruins of a Roman theater. The city's golden age, however, was during the medieval and Renaissance periods, when rival noble families built the towers and palaces that define its skyline. The city is famously constructed almost entirely from local travertine marble, giving its centro storico a unified, luminous beauty. The undisputed heart is Piazza del Popolo, a Renaissance masterpiece considered one of Italy's most beautiful squares, flanked by the Gothic Church of San Francesco and the elegant Palazzo dei Capitani del Popolo. Ascoli is also renowned for its cultural traditions, including the Quintana, a spectacular historical jousting tournament held in August. The city is a hub for the surrounding area, known for its olives, vineyards, and proximity to the Monti Sibillini National Park. Its compact historic center is the main district for visitors, containing nearly all key sites within a labyrinth of charming streets and lesser-known piazzas waiting to be discovered.
Best Time to Visit Ascoli Piceno
The ideal times to visit Ascoli Piceno are late spring (May-June) and early autumn (September-October). During these periods, the weather is pleasantly warm and sunny, perfect for exploring the travertine streets and outdoor cafes, with fewer crowds than peak summer. Summer (July-August) brings hot, dry weather and the city's major event, the Quintana festival in August, a vibrant medieval joust and pageant that fills the city with costumed parades and excitement. However, this is also peak tourist season. Winter (November-March) is cooler and quieter, with occasional rain and the chance of snow in the surrounding mountains, offering a more local experience and the cozy atmosphere of historic cafes. Early spring (April) can be lovely but somewhat unpredictable with showers. For a balance of good weather, cultural events, and manageable visitor numbers, the shoulder months of May, June, and September are highly recommended.
